Teifi sightings

The 2nd winter Iceland Gull was in the estuary yesterday - Sunday.
(Jon Green)

To bring in Spring, Wendy saw a Sandwich Tern flying out of the estuary this morning.
Six Wheatears on the Ceredigion side too, by the Cliff Hotel.

From St. Dogmael's Quay late afternoon now FOUR Red-breasted Mergansers including three drakes. Shelduck numbers declined today to 28.
